[!IMPORTANT] The 12-Inch Aesthetic! To perform a high-fidelity audit, always logistically remember that standard North American pitch informatics are normalized to a "12-Inch Run." A 4:12 pitch represents 4 inches of rise for every 12 inches of run.

Step-by-Step Slope Audit Example

Let's audit a roof with a 6-inch rise and a standard 12-inch run aesthetic:

  1. Informatics Initialization: Rise = 6", Run = 12".
  2. Ratio Analytic: 6:12 (Mid-Slope Aesthetic).
  3. Angular Logistic: \(\arctan(6/12) = 26.6°\) inclination mass.
  4. Grade Diagnostic: (6/12) × 100 = 50% slope logistics.
  5. Final Audit: Walkable architectural tier stabilized.
